Leadership expert Simon Sinek is perhaps best known for giving one of the most popular TED talks of all time, “The Golden Circle Theory,” where he explains how leaders can inspire cooperation, trust and change in a business, based on his research into how the most successful organizations think, act and communicate if they start with “Why.”

Prior to the Learning Lab, we will share this Simon Sinek TED Talk and value proposition questions with the participants.

The workshop will focus on:

● What research and neuroscience tells us about the Golden Circle theory, and how humans respond best when messages communicate with those parts of their brain that control emotions, behavior and decision making

● How passionate leaders and organizations express their commitment and enthusiasm authentically to inspire audiences

● Providing the tools to successfully articulate their “Why” to clients, employees and stakeholders to inspire them to act or buy

After the workshop, the businesses will work on their “Why” and then you will conduct a remote 2-hour 1:1 Consulting Meeting for each business to discuss it and provide constructive feedback.

 

Provide a two-hour, individual consultation for each Learning Lab participant, to discuss the information presented and provide actionable feedback. 

Bpeace will provide you with a recording of the Learning Lab and any accompanying Powerpoint for preparation and background.

Before the calls begin, we will walk you through the format of the calls, the types of questions to ask, and best practices generally (this will be done either via a call with Bpeace staff and/or via a recorded video for you to watch).

We will also provide you with a summary report of each of the businesses you will meet with in advance so you have a basic understanding of their business and goals.

Bpeace staff is also on each call with you and is available to answer any questions before, during, and/or after calls. Professional simultaneous interpretation is provided if any of the businesses' team does not speak English.

Bpeace - Business Council for Peace

We believe the path to peace is lined with jobs. We work with entrepreneurs in crisis-affected communities to scale their businesses, create significant employment for all and expand the economic power of women. More jobs mean less violence.®
